Michael Moore Wants You and Your Friends to Vote for ObamaPosted on Nov 2, 2012
Did you know that 90 million Americans are planning to not vote on Election Day? While that fact may have eluded you, filmmaker Michael Moore is painfully aware of it. So much so that he’s asking you, the voter, not just to cast your ballot, but to get at least one of your nonvoting friends to tag along. Moore writes at The Huffington Post:
Moore is somewhat empathetic with the plight of the nonvoter. He understands why you might be planning to sit this one out.
Still, Moore argues that, as disillusioned as this group of potential voters is, they should go and cast their ballots. He says that this group in fact secretly does want to vote, and that it’s up to the voting citizen to make sure they do so.
It’s clear that Moore is asking that you, and of course the friend you’re dragging along to the polls, vote for Obama.
